PMDC clears registration backlog
Islamabad:The Pakistan Medical and Dental Council has announced the successful resolution of a significant number of cases regarding teaching experience, postgraduate registration, good standing, foreign local verification and registration certificates.
A year ago, the PMDC faced substantial backlog issues due to manual operations, but they're significantly addressed through the launch of state-of-the-art online portals to the relief of medical and dental practitioners.
The portals were designed to streamline the registration and documentation processes, effectively addressing the obstacles to smooth certificate issuance, according to PMDC president Prof Rizwan Taj.
He said the upgraded system had reflected an enhancement in administrative efficiency while eliminating loopholes and bolstering functionality. He said digital transformation, especially the launch of online portals led to the speedy disposal of cases.
According to him, the PMDC received 120,391 applications for teaching experience, postgraduate registration, good standing, foreign local verification and registration certificates in the last one year. Of them, 117,824 have been disposed of, with only 400-500 cases pending mainly due to third-party verifications.
He said the PMDC received 19,109 applications for full licences in the last one year and action was taken on 19,101 of them. Also, 17,693 provisional registration licences were submitted for verification and 17,500 of them have been cleared. Prof Taj said the launch of online portals had streamlined processes by simplifying case submissions and ensuring faster reviews and resolutions.
